Balanced Meals for Optimal Health

A healthy daily eating habit starts with a balanced meal. Ensure that every meal includes a variety of food groups: vegetables, fruits,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ats. The ideal plate should consist of half vegetables and fruits, a quarter of lean proteins like chicken or beans, and a quarter of whole grains such as brown rice or quinoa. This will help provide the necessary nutrients for your body while keeping your calorie intake in check.

Importance of Hydration

Drinking enough water is crucial for overall health. Water aids digestion, regulates body temperature, and helps remove toxins from the body. Aim to drink at least 8 cups (2 liters) of water a day. Herbal teas and other hydrating beverages can also contribute to your daily water intake, but be mindful of added sugars in sweetened drinks.

Limiting Processed Foods

Processed foods are often high in unhealthy fats, sugars, and sodium. These foods can contribute to weight gain and increase the risk of developing health issues. Try to limit your consumption of fast food, packaged snacks, and sugary beverages. Instead, opt for whole foods that are minimally processed and rich in nutrients.

Eating Mindfully

Mindful eating involves paying full attention to the taste, texture, and aroma of your food. By eating slowly and savoring each bite, you can avoid overeating and improve digestion. Focus on hunger cues and eat until you are comfortably full, not stuffed. Practicing mindfulness while eating helps develop a healthy relationship with food.

Snacking Wisely

When it comes to snacking, choose healthier options like fresh fruits, nuts, and yogurt instead of processed snacks. These nutrient-dense snacks will keep you satisfied between meals and provide essential vitamins and minerals. Prepare healthy snacks ahead of time to avoid temptation when hunger strikes.
